What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an insurance associate?

To thrive as an Insurance Associate, you need a solid understanding of insurance products, policy administration, and basic financial principles, typically backed by a relevant degree or prior experience in insurance or customer service. Familiarity with insurance management software, CRM systems, and sometimes state insurance licensing is often required. Strong interpersonal communication, attention to detail, and problem-solving skills help you excel in client interactions and policy management. These skills ensure accurate policy processing, regulatory compliance, and high-quality customer service in a competitive industry.

What are some common challenges insurance associates face when assisting clients, and how can these be managed effectively?

Insurance Associates often encounter challenges such as explaining complex policy details to clients, managing a high volume of inquiries, and keeping up with frequent regulatory changes. To manage these, it's helpful to develop strong communication and organizational skills, stay updated through ongoing training, and use digital tools provided by the agency. Collaborating closely with underwriters, claims adjusters, and senior agents can also provide valuable support and insights for handling client needs efficiently.

What is the role of an insurance associate?

An insurance associate assists clients with insurance policies, provides quotes, processes claims, and explains coverage options. They often work in insurance agencies or companies, requiring strong communication skills and knowledge of insurance products.

Job Description

To receive on radio frequency monitors (RF) and stock or split out freight from UPS and other Freight lines. 


Qualifications

  • Education: High school diploma or GED 
  • Experience: 3-12 months preferred

Key Responsibilities

  • Receive Freight
  • Enter the P.O. number, or scan a UPC code to find the P.O.
  • Log the P.O. if not already logged
  • Scan item and enter quantity received
  • Pull items for split out And load and scan onto pallets items for stock need to be put on shelf and scanned to shelf
  • Scan ID on the pallets/shelves
  • If needed, place tickets on items that do not have UPC's
  • Request price tickets per buyer instructions
  • Deliver items marked to attention of a buyer, advertising, etc.


  • Send Out Direct Bill Items
  • Sort by stores
  • Put direct billing stickers on with information completed
  • Complete direct bill packing list and turn into office
  • Pack cases on pallets


  • Build Pallets
  • Pack merchandise on pallets 
  • Ensure that heavy items are lowest on pallet 
  • Shrink wrap pallets tightly 
  • Label pallets with store number and bar code
  • Move pallets using electric or hand pallet jack to staging area 


  • Load And Unload Trucks
  • Using pallet jacks, fork lifts, etc. load/unload merchandise       


  • Clean Up
  • Sweep floor 
  • Move pallets 
  • Empty trash cans and dumpsters 


  • Other Duties as Requested by Management
  • Help in other areas of warehouse when needed
  • Any other tasks as assigned by management 
  • Assist with training of new associates 
  • Ensure receiving staging area is kept orderly (pallets arranged by date received)

Physical Demands

Frequent physical demands include lifting up to 50 lbs., walking, standing, bending, twisting, reaching, pushing, pulling, squatting, kneeling, dexterity and light grasping. Occasional physical demands include lifting up to 75 lbs. and climbing stairs. The associate is required to talk and hear. Must be able to work required shifts and maintain attendance standards. Specific vision abilities required by this job include vision adequate for the incumbent to perform the responsibilities and functions of the job efficiently. The associate must have the manual dexterity to manually operate and use a computer, and a RF handheld scanner.

Work Environment and Working Conditions

Work will normally be performed inside of a warehouse facility. Temperatures can vary from 32 degrees to 100 degrees. The work environment is usually fast paced with regular deadlines. Extreme noise and vibrations may occasionally be experienced. Associates may be subjected to hazards such as burns, cuts, strains, electrical, explosive, and mechanical. Due to the nature of the work, associates may be exposed to atmospheric conditions such as dust fumes, odors, and poor ventilation. For the safety of our associates, all associates are required to wear protective steel toed shoes as well as other protective devices that management deems appropriate.
